--- old/test/hotspot/jtreg/serviceability/jvmti/HeapMonitor/MyPackage/HeapMonitorNoCapabilityTest.java 2018-03-28 08:20:27.269191679 -0700 +++ new/test/hotspot/jtreg/serviceability/jvmti/HeapMonitor/MyPackage/HeapMonitorNoCapabilityTest.java 2018-03-28 08:20:26.949192851 -0700 @@ -26,22 +26,12 @@ /** * @test * @summary Verifies the JVMTI Heap Monitor does not work without the required capability. + * @build Frame HeapMonitor * @compile HeapMonitorNoCapabilityTest.java * @run main/othervm/native -agentlib:HeapMonitor MyPackage.HeapMonitorNoCapabilityTest */ public class HeapMonitorNoCapabilityTest { - static { - try { - System.loadLibrary("HeapMonitor"); - } catch (UnsatisfiedLinkError ule) { - System.err.println("Could not load HeapMonitor library"); - System.err.println("java.library.path: " - + System.getProperty("java.library.path")); - throw ule; - } - } - private native static int allSamplingMethodsFail(); public static void main(String[] args) {